Developing a Sportsbook
A sportsbook is a gambling establishment that accepts bets on different sporting events. Its main goal is to provide a fun and exciting environment for bettors. It also aims to generate revenue and attract more customers. However, the success of a sportsbook depends on a number of factors, including its legality and regulatory compliance. The process of creating a sportsbook involves several steps, and it is important to consult a lawyer or a reputable law firm when starting out. Developing a sportsbook without a proper legal framework can lead to costly errors and potentially even jail time.
In order to make money, a sportsbook must charge a fair amount of commission. This way, they can ensure that their bettors will return to place more bets in the future. Typically, they will charge a 10% commission on each bet that is placed at the sportsbook. However, this rate varies from one sportsbook to another, and can be more or less depending on their margins.
Another key factor is the sportsbook’s bonus programs. While it is common for users to compare sportsbooks to see which offers the best bonuses, they should not be the only determining factor. Users should also look at the sportsbook’s terms and conditions, regulations, and rules to understand how they work.
When it comes to developing a sportsbook, it is essential to understand how a customer perceives it and what makes it attractive to them. This will help you to create an app that is unique and will appeal to the target audience. For example, a sportsbook that offers free picks and odds is likely to appeal to fans of MMA and boxing who are looking for new ways to bet on their favorite teams.
Having a sportsbook can be extremely profitable, especially if it is used properly. However, it’s important to remember that the industry is highly competitive and that your margins are razor-thin. That’s why it’s essential to develop a sportsbook that offers a high-quality user experience and provides the tools your customers need to be successful.
In addition to offering excellent odds and spreads, sportsbooks should also focus on other features that will engage users. This includes things like player profiles, live streams, and news. A sportsbook that lacks these elements will not be able to compete with its competitors.
In addition, sportsbooks should offer multiple payment options. This is particularly important if the sportsbook is located in a country with strict regulations for online gambling. This way, the sportsbook will be able to comply with local laws and regulations and protect its customers. It is also a good idea to offer a loyalty program, as this will encourage users to come back and place bets. Moreover, it will show that the sportsbook cares about its customers and is invested in their long-term success. It will also help them build brand trust and improve their customer satisfaction.